Town property damaged
A mirror was damaged at a building owned by the Town of Clayton Monday, according to police. Employee Ian Crowell reported that a rock had been thrown at a glass mirror inside a bathroom on Amelia Church Road. Damage to the property was estimated at $100.
Employee suspected of embezzlement
Smithfield police are investigating another embezzlement report from Texas Steakhouse on Industrial Park Drive. Last week, a worker from the restaurant was arrested for allegedly taking $120.Tuesday morning, a company representative told Smithfield police that an employee embezzled $200 from the restaurant sometime between Feb. 29 and March 1, according to a report.
Man reports robbery
A Washington, D.C. man told Smithfield police that someone brandishing a knife robbed him of $900 Tuesday. The incident took place about 3:30 p.m. in a parking lot of 600 S. Bright Leaf Blvd. The man said a robber forced him to hand over the cash, and $40 was later recovered, according to a report.
